  • the present invention relates to an electrical connector housing element, to male or female electrical contact members intended to equip such a housing element, as well as to a tool for removing these organs, for example, if they are to be changed.
  • the invention relates to electrical connector housing elements of the type comprising a body with a series of channels intended to each receive an electrical contact member, each channel comprising means combined with an electrical contact member for locking the latter. -this.
  • the housing element is of the type comprising a module comprising a series of channels intended to each receive an electrical contact member comprising a body with, at one end, means for connecting an electrical conductor, while the other end is intended to receive a complementary electrical contact member, said body having a shoulder intended to cooperate with a first stop of an elastic tongue provided in said corresponding channel, said element housing being characterized in that the electrical contact member has, projecting, an elastic retaining lug extending in the direction of the crimping lugs, while the elastic tongue has a second stop intended to cooperate with the free end of the retaining tab, a case being provided and arranged to present a housing intended to receive the module and to lock it, said elastic tab and the housing being arranged so that, when the module is inserted in said housing of the 'holster, said elastic tongue is blocked.
  • a connector housing element is produced in which the contact member is fixed by a double locking mechanism and in which, when the module is inserted in the case, the elastic tongue cannot be lifted inopportune.
  • the case comprises means to oppose the establishment of the module in the housing if the electrical contact member is not properly 'inserted into the channel.
  • the housing of the case has a recess against which can abut the free end of the elastic tongue if the female electrical contact member is not properly inserted into the channel.
  • the case comprises a hook, while the corresponding wall of the module is provided with a lug intended to cooperate with the hook to ensure the locking of the module in the housing of the case.
  • the electrical contact member comprises two elastic tabs arranged on either side of the body, while the module has a second elastic tongue provided with a stop with which the free end cooperates. of the second elastic tab.
  • the elastic tongue in the vicinity of its free end, includes a boss intended to bear against the corresponding end of the electrical contact member.
  • each elastic tongue has, at its free end, a boss, the bosses facing each other and being intended to enclose the electrical contact member.
  • the invention also relates to a tool which facilitates the extraction of an electrical contact member from its channel, said tool being characterized in that it consists of a U-shaped element with a core and two wings intended to cooperate with the electrical contact member so as to lift the elastic tabs to release the corresponding elastic tabs and fold them against the body of the electrical contact member.

Abstract

The invention relates to an electrical connector box element and the corresponding electrical contact member. The invention is of the type that consists of a module (11) which is intended to receive electrical contact members (1) comprising a body having a shoulder which is intended to co-operate with a first stop element (13) of an elastic tongue (12) of the module. The invention is characterised in that the electrical contact member (1) is equipped with at least one projecting elastic retaining tab (8), while the elastic tongue (12) is equipped with a second stop element (14) which is intended to co-operate with the free end of the retaining tab (8). The invention also comprises a case (20) with a housing which is intended to receive the module (11) and to lock same together with the elastic tongue (12).
